A few points from a long term owner. 1. The back seats are MUCH more comfortable if you put the head rests up. The headrest interferes with your back/neck sitting against the backrest properly. 2. The factory leather option XR5s are actually 4 seater cars, only the cloth/fabric XR5s are legally 5 seaters. Says so on the plaque in the door frame (I think on the B-pillar). Factory leather equipped cars don’t even have seat belts for the rear middle “seat”. Some XR5s have been retrofitted with leather seats later in life, hence why they’re a 5 seater. Just check the door plaque. I’ve had my LV XR5 for 8 years. Love it. Bit heavy on fuel if just in traffic constantly, but enjoyable. Love the mechanical nature of it, the 6 speed is nice. Sounds great. With the rear seats folded down, it can take a tonne (not literally) of stuff in the back, so it’s quite versatile. Despite versatility it’s a rewarding drive. No, it won’t ever be the fastest car in a straight line, but it was never designed to be. Sits on a freeway comfortably, but also is quite competent in twisty roads (even before suspension mods). As for the AC, there’s a pretty well known issue where the compressor clutch material wears away and the clutch goes out of tolerance. Can be remedied by removal of one shim in the Ac compressor clutch (there are videos on YT) or buy a new compressor. Do not buy through ford, it’ll cost you a lot. You can buy the genuine compressor through XR5 specialists and save hundreds. The PCV diaphragm can be bought separately to save a lot of money too. There are issues with the bonnet lock, usually because people don’t know how to open it properly. Ignition key goes into the bonnet lock (behind the front ford badge) and press down on the bonnet, turn key to the left, let bonnet rise onto the catch then turn key to the right and you can lift the bonnet up. There’s a small white plastic piece in the lock that ford put in as an anti theft device, which breaks if you don’t open the bonnet properly. You can buy that plastic piece, you can upgraded pieces, ypu can buy the whole lock assembly, you can install the mondeo bonnet latch (with traditional under dash lever), or you can remove the bonnet latch completely and use bonnet catches (like Aero catches). If the bonnet latch breaks there are videos of what to do. You need a really long screwdriver basically, but if it does break you aren’t the only one it’s happened to so there is info out there. These are great modified if modified correctly. Any crackle tunes are idiotic and asking for a cracked liners. The liner issue is a bit random too, some very powerful cars have no issue while some stock do (random hey), but you can stop it by doing the block mod. This involves putting little shims that fill the factory gaps between bores. It’s peace of mind security. Best basic mod for these is a proper stage 1 tune from a reputable supplier (OEM Denied is one based in QLD, there are a few really good others too). Factory they have boost limits on 1st and 2nd gears, making the car sedate. Stage 1 tune sorts that out and can make the car nicer to drive. A resonator delete helps make sweet sweet 5 cylinder noises without drone. There are good full aftermarket exhausts that are drone free too, just takes some looking into. As mentioned in the video, other great mods are an LSD and RS clutch (you do both together to save on labour - RS clutch is similar feel to stock but much stronger and still quiet), rear sway bar, short shift kit. Best thing for a car this age is to also redo the suspension, whether you go new good shocks and springs or coilovers, but all the factory rubbers. They’ll tighten the car up back to factory spec (or harder if desired). Cruise control was not available in Focus XR5s (despite being on Mondeo XR5s), but can be added, probably around $900-$1k supplied and fitted by most decent auto electricians New head units are easy to install with Aerpro kits. Super easy, I installed a Kenwood DMX8520dabs with wireless Android Auto and CarPlay for less than $1k. Awesome headunit offering more than many new hot hatches. Tonnes of great headunit upgrades for a few hundred dollars, so the ICE can be upgraded very cheaply. Definitely underrated, but buyers need to be realistic. This will not be as quick as an i30N, Golf R, or AMG A45, but it’s also tens of thousands less. What the XR5 will do over those is give aural sounds that only 5 cylinders can give (we’re talking RS3 type sounds), and those other 4 cylinder turbos can only dream of.

You missed a few issues, the dash cluster can suffer from bad soldering which throws up weird faults, the bonnet release will break easily as its only plastic , they have a big turning circle for a little car, the headlights on mine were like burning candles to see at night and the pedal box on mine failed due to plastic bushings wearing out. The tourque mount on the engine will also break at sometime in its life and the clutch lasts about as long as timing belts if you are lucky. Outside of that a fantastic car to drive, I really enjoyed mine so much that when it got retired at 175000 Ks I parked it in my shed and its still there as I couldnt part with it. I replaced the Focus with a new WRX and that got sold after 5 years because it was costing me more to service and repair than the XR5

B5254T3. Acessorie belts can shred they wrap around the crank and timing gear and will skip teeth and smash valves. A lot of the mounts tend to be cracked, hoses swollen. Also if the cam seals leak, its because the gears are worn, new gears are around $800 plus fitting. Also if buying watch for leaking PCVs, that can be caused by excess crank case pressure, usually caused by crackle maps with over fueling causing bore wash and worn rings so do a compression test when buying and avoid any cars with photos of them shooting flames. Also pull the oil filter, check the pleats for metal, these engines tend to spin bearings if they dont run the right oil. Avoid green coolant, its the wrong stuff, you'll blow a head gasket with it. I own a 2010 XR5 Turbo. Bought it a few years ago with 150,000KMs for $10,500. A few things to note: 1. You're 1000% right about it coming to life with good tyres. Mine came with pretty bad ones and it just spun the wheels all through 1st, 2nd and even third. It was very hard to launch. I put some Pirelli P-Zeros on and even with traction control off it just grips up and flies away. 2. Traction control is a nightmare. It's just way too aggressive, I permanently drive with it off, it cuts power even when I'm driving it normally. Your average 0-100 time will probably drop 1-2 seconds just by turning it off. 3. For maintenance - it actually says in the logbook to do the timing belt at 150,000KMs or every 10 years. Since all of these cars are over 10 years old, low mileage examples should get it done asap. It is a little pricey (I paid $1500 with the water pump and aux belts) but if the belt jumps you're looking at replacing the whole engine ($5000+). I had to do the PCV in my car too. Mine had an engine mount split, apparently it's common as well. PCV costed me about $1000 to fix. Engine mount was about $400. Besides these it's pretty good. 4. It's reaaally thirsty on petrol. It only takes 98, I'm running a stage 1 tune and average about 11.5L/100KMs. With petrol prices soaring bear this in mind. You're looking at ~$120 to fill it up and it'll do about 400-500KMs depending on how you drive it. 5. This is one of the cheapest cars you can modify. It's very easy to get more power. The main limitation is the downpipe and the turbo intercooler. Replacing these 2 + a better panel filter will take you from 225HP to 300HP reliably. For around $2000 as well. There's plenty of handling mods too, sway bars, torque mounts etc. 6. I'm a little biased here but it's by far the best sounding car in it's price bracket. Even in stock form it sounds great, I have a resonated dreamscience catback + cold air intake + turbosmart recirc valve and it brings it to life. It completely smashes the GTIs, WRXs etc in the sound department. You nailed it in the video, the 5cyl really gives it character that the others lack. Would highly recommend this car especially to P platers, it's a great car to learn in, great car to drive, I'm planning on selling mine (it's getting up there in KMs) just to buy another one.
